Eastman Machine hit by strike (Buffalo)
Thomas Hartley
Business First

Members of United Auto Workers union Local 936 are picketing Eastman Machine Co., 779 Washington St., in a dispute which the union says involves job security.

The two sides had been meeting in the presence of a federal mediator since late September when a 1-year contract expired. Talks broke off March 11 when no progress was reached. Further meetings have not been scheduled.

UAW area director Kevin Donovan said 20 jobs have been lost since the company shifted some work last year to China where it established a joint venture. Local 936 represents 70 production workers, he said. <snip>
